About The Book

Jorge Mario Bergoglio became Pope Francis on March 13 2013 when he was named the 266th pope of the Roman Catholic Church. Bergoglio the first pope from the Americas took his papal title after St. Francis of Assisi of Italy. Prior to his election as pope Bergoglio served as archbishop of Buenos Aires from 1998 to 2013 (succeeding Antonio Quarracino) as cardinal of the Roman Catholic Church of Argentina from 2001 to 2013 and as president of the Bishops Conference of Argentina from 2005 to 2011.
